Caravaggio The Beheading Of St John The Baptist

The artwork depicts the beheading of Saint John the Baptist. Caravaggio used his signature naturalistic and dramatic style, incorporating strong chiaroscuro to create a highly emotive scene. The colors are predominantly dark with deep shadows and selective lighting. Caravaggio utilized oil paint on canvas for this masterpiece, which allowed him to achieve intricate details in texture and shading. The painting is rich in symbolism, highlighting themes of martyrdom, religious devotion, sinfulness, and redemption. It also emphasizes Caravaggio's preference for rendering figures realistically rather than idealistically.

Style

Caravaggio was known as one of the pioneers of the Baroque art movement characterized by its theatricality and emotional intensity. His artistic style can be described as tenebrism due to his use of sharp contrasts between light and darkness. In "The Beheading Of St John The Baptist," Caravaggio sets a somber tone through his realistic portrayal that brings viewers into immediate contact with the brutality depicted within the narrative.
